Description:


Previously published as the first volume of The Encyclopedia
of Global Human Migration, this work is devoted exclusively to
prehistoric migration, covering all periods and places from the
first hominin migrations out of Africa through the end of
prehistory.


Presents interdisciplinary coverage of this topic, including
scholarship from the fields of archaeology, anthropology, genetics,
biology, linguistics, and more

Includes contributions from a diverse international team of
authors, representing 17 countries and a variety of
disciplines

Divided into two sections, covering the Pleistocene and
Holocene; each section examines human migration through chapters
that focus on different regional and disciplinary lenses
